The Effect of Defect Sites on the Dissociation of NO on PT(111) Surface

  • Adorption of nitric oxide on the Pt(III) surface sputtered by Ar-ion has been studied using thermal desorption spectroscopy and Auger electron spectroscopy. Ar-ion sputtering creates a precursor state of ($NO\beta$ stage) adsorbe dat defect sites. The precursor state is characterized by the terminal bent species . At low coverge mos 샐 adsorbed NO dissociates . And as increasing the coverage, the fraction of dissociation remains about 80%.

  • Existing data structures for non-manifold solid modelers use basic dat entities, such as vertex, edge, loop, face, shell, and region to find adjacency relationships. But, no one clearly identified what additional types of data entitles are necessary to represent incidence relationships. In this paper, we classified the boundary information of vertex, edge, face , and region from the 3-D space view. As the results we can clearly define the boundary information required for adjacency relationships. The existing B-rep data structures for solid modeler are compared whether they have the required boundary information.

  • In this paper we propose a mixed-effects least squares support vector regression (LS-SVR) for longitudinal data. We add a random-effect term in the optimization function of LS-SVR to take random effects into LS-SVR for analyzing longitudinal data. We also present the model selection method that employs generalized cross validation function for choosing the hyper-parameters which affect the performance of the mixed-effects LS-SVR. A simulated example is provided to indicate the usefulness of mixed-effect method for analyzing longitudinal data.

Source-Sink Partitioning of Mineral Nutrients and Photo-assimilates in Tomato Plants Grown under Suboptimal Nutrition

  • A huge number of greenhouse soils in Korea have accumulated mineral elements which induce many nutritional and pathological problems. The present study was performed to the effects of the reduced fertilization on plant growth, and uptake and partitioning of minerals (N, P, K) and soluble carbohydrates using highly minerals-accumulated farmer's greenhouse soil. On the basis of the recommended application for tomato crop, the application rates of N, P and K were 110(50%)-5.2(5%)-41.5(35%)kg $ha^{-1}$, respectively, using Hoagland's nutrient solution. Tomato growth rates during the whole experiment were not significant between treatments, but it was found that a decrease in daily growth represented after 60 days of treatment (DAT). The reduced application led to a drastic decrease in the concentration of N, P and K in fruits, and, thus, this resulted in lower uptake after 40 DAT. The lower phloem export and utilization of soluble carbohydrates caused an accumulation of extra-carbohydrates in leaves, stems and fruits in the reduced application. The reduced fertilization induced the capture of N, P and K in leaves and of soluble carbohydrates in stems compared to the conventional application. In this study, we suggest that it is possible to delay the first fertigation time in minerals-accumulated soils without an adverse impact on crop growth, but it is necessary to regularly monitor mineral status in soil to ensure a balanced uptake, synthesis and partitioning of minerals and carbohydrates.
